Welcome to the November 2022 One Good Kiwi Roundup, where we share the charities launching on the app in December and the charities which received the most tokens and therefore the largest donation in November. If you don’t already know, One Good Kiwi is a mobile and web app which features ten charities each month and gives regular New Zealanders the opportunity to vote on which charity receives the biggest share of Vodafone cash each month.

The ten charities featured on One Good Kiwi for December are;

  • Youthline – Supporting young people with 24/7 mental health support.
  • Billy Graham Youth Foundation – Supporting and championing young people through the sport of boxing.
  • Code Club Aotearoa – Helping to give every Kiwi kid the opportunity to learn to code with the hopes of building a better future.
  • Lifewise Aotearoa – Giving rangatahi a home, celebration and aroha this Christmas.
  • Crescendo Trust – Using the power of music to help rangatahi to create positive future.
  • Recreate – Creating life changing experiences for young people with disabilities.
  • South Seas Bubblegum – Supporting and increasing the capability of Māori and Pacific youth through learning experiences.
  • Kiwi Christmas Books – Collecting books to gift to Kiwi kids who would otherwise go without at Christmas.
  • City Missions – Helping communities doing it tough across Aotearoa with food, gifts and social work this Christmas.
  • Shift – Creating a future to help young people who identify as a women flourish in Aotearoa.

We’re also super excited to announce that VOYCE Whakarongo Mai will receive $30,970 after our 33% of One Good Kiwi users swiped tokens their way. VOYCE Whakarongo Mai does amazing work advocating for children in foster care, uplifting their voices within the system.
